Citation: von Ehr, Julian; Korn, Sophie Marianne; Weiss, Lena; Schlundt, Andreas. "1H, 13C, 15N backbone chemical shift assignments of the extended ARID domain in human AT-rich interactive domain protein 5a (Arid5a)" Biomol. NMR Assign. 17, 121-127 (2023).
PubMed: 37129704
Assembly members:
entity_1, polymer, 108 residues, 12680 Da.
Natural source: Common Name: Human Taxonomy ID: 9606 Superkingdom: Eukaryota Kingdom: Metazoa Genus/species: Homo sapiens
Experimental source: Production method: recombinant technology Host organism: Escherichia coli Vector: pET-Trx1a
